Response of beetles (Coleoptera) to repeated applications of prescribed fire and other fuel reduction techniques in the southern Appalachian Mountains

•Coleoptera abundance and diversity were similar in all fuel reduction treatments.•Chrysomelidae was significantly more abundant in mechanical and burn treatments.•Staphylinidae abundance was significantly lower in mechanical and burn treatments.•Fire reduced the canopy cover and increased plant cover on the forest floor.•Repeated application of fuel reduction techniques can alter beetle abundances.
